Summary:

"The Campus Guide: Harvard University offers an insider's view of America's oldest college and a guided tour of the campus and its landmark buildings, from nineteenth-century works by Charles Bulfinch and Henry Hobson Richardson, to twentieth-century designs by McKim, Mead & White, Walter Gropius, Jose Luis Sert, and Le Corbusier, to twenty-first-century designs by James Stirling and Renzo Piano." "The Harvard University Campus Guide is fascinating to read and an easy-to-use companion for a walking tour. It features over one hundred thirty buildings and spans four hundred years. With a foreword by Harvard's twenty-sixth president, Neil L. Rudenstine, and striking photographs by Richard Cheek, this is the definitive guide to the history and architecture of the oldest and foremost institution of higher learning in the United State."--BOOK JACKET.
